The Most Handsome Man

In her words of grace, the most handsome man,
With eyes that gleam like stars that shine,
His heart, a canvas of love's embrace,
In every step, his soul she's traced.

Yet above all splendor, his heart's true light,
A love for Sara, pure and bright,
Her name on lips, a cherished prayer,
Their bond, a tapestry rich and rare.

Through life's embrace, hand in hand they roam,
For in her love, he finds his home.
